Who does not enlogize the vow of celibacy which barns down all faults, as a lamp does moths, which like the moon alleviates agonies and which like the ocean produces the jewels of virtue ?
42
Every moment one should be attentive in observing the row of celibacy which, like the sun shining with full lustre, destroys the entire darkness of calamities and which, like the wish-yielding tree, gives the desired objects.
... 43 Those high-minded persons intent upon observing the vow of celibacy, to whom Indra, the lord of the gods, humble with pure devotion, bows down, while taking his seat on the throne, are always victorious in the Earth.
3. When the vow of celibacy, which leads to life of highly auspicious state, shines forth, the sacred Mantras fructify, the fame spreads over the Earth and even the gods honour the chaste persons with their paesence.
